Output 643760317a5dba1d6c670cdff73e81c4b02de486eaebc44ec1cd663c685e2c93:3
- value
- 552370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ec01376fcbe0199845af96b292bed8281adc4792 OP_EQUAL
- address
- 3PCtrLrPEXad7KEJTvjAUKTv2UsenAEN17
- transaction
- 643760317a5dba1d6c670cdff73e81c4b02de486eaebc44ec1cd663c685e2c93
- confirmations
- 439909
- spent
- true